Sırçalı Medrese, meaning 'Glazed Madrasa,' is a masterpiece of Seljuk architecture, renowned for its brilliant turquoise-tiled dome and intricate stone carvings. Built in 1242, it once served as a theological school. Today, it functions as a museum showcasing Seljuk-era artifacts, including ceramic tiles, woodwork, and tombstones. The central courtyard, with its two-story arcade and the dazzling dome overhead, is a highlight. Visitors can explore the former student cells and the prayer hall, gaining insight into medieval Islamic education and artistry.
